네트워크를 이루는 장치 이해 - 어플리케이션 계층

carlkim·2023년 11월 6일
0

CS학습 - 네트워크

목록 보기
36/48

L7 스위치 (로드밸런서)

L7 스위치는 로드밸런서라고도 하며, 서버의 부하를 분산하는 기기입니다.
서버 이중화, 보안에 강점이 있는 장치입니다. IP, PORT 뿐만 아니라 URL, 헤더, 쿠키 등을 기반으로 트래픽을 분산합니다. 헬스체크를 통해 장애가 발생한 서버를 확인하고 해당 서버로 트래픽을 보내지 못하게 하는 역할을 합니다.

사용자가 요청을 로드밸런서에 보내면 로드밸런서가 상황에 맞춰서
요청을 서버에 전달한다.

근데 서버 한 대가 문제가 생겼다하면 다른 서버로 요청을 보내준다.

헬스체크라는 행위가 필요하다, 로드 밸런서와 연결된 서버들에게 TCP 요청을 보낸다.

TCP 3웨이 핸드셰이크로 살았는지 죽었는지 확인한다.

AWS에서 APPLICATION LOAD BALANCER(L7 스위치)로 쉽게 구현 가능하다.

NEWWORK LOAD BALANCER는 L4 스위치이다.

profile
가장 나답게 문제해결.

0개의 댓글